Epigenetic Regulation of Gene Expression in Physiological and Pathological Brain Processes
Abstract
Over the past decade, it has become increasingly obvious that epigenetic mechanisms are an integral part of a multitude of brain functions that range from the development of the nervous system over basic neuronal functions to higher order cognitive processes.
